Theatre Commander General Adeniyi sent back to school after viral video of him complaining about Boko Haram insurgents having more ammunition

The video of Theatre Commander General Adeniyi complaining about Boko Haram insurgents having more ammunition went viral. As a result, he has been sent back to school as a research fellow at the Nigerian Army Resource Centre (NARC) in Abuja. Major General Faruk Yahaya has been deployed to replace Adeniyi, who had been in charge of Operation Lafiya Dole since 2019.

The Nigerian Army’s spokesman, Sagir Musa, stated the new postings were a routine exercise intended to reinvigorate the system for greater professional effectiveness and efficiency. However, social media users contended that Adeniyi’s deployment was a vindictive move by Buratai because Adeniyi told an embarrassing truth.

The full statement announcing the new postings highlighted various other senior officers’ reassignments and appointments, with all changes taking effect from April 1, 2020. The Chief of Army Staff urged the officers to take their new responsibilities seriously and discharge all duties professionally with utmost loyalty to the Nation and the Service.
